Manavi

Manavi is a quaint village in Georgia's Kakheti region, situated near the Alazani River. Known for its picturesque landscapes and traditional Georgian charm, Manavi offers visitors a glimpse into rural life. The village is surrounded by vineyards and fields, reflecting the region's strong agricultural heritage. It is also notable for its historical and cultural sites, including local churches and ancient ruins, making it an interesting stop for those exploring the Kakheti wine country and Georgian traditions.

Bodbe Monastery of St. Nino

Bodbe Cathedral, located in the Bodbe Monastery complex in Georgia's Kakheti region, is a significant religious and historical site. This cathedral, part of a larger monastery complex, is dedicated to St. Nino, the revered figure who is credited with introducing Christianity to Georgia. The current structure, built in the 9th century, showcases traditional Georgian architectural styles and has been a focal point for pilgrims and visitors seeking spiritual solace. The cathedral is renowned for its beautiful frescoes, serene atmosphere, and its role in preserving Georgia's rich Christian heritage.

Telavi

In Telavi, you can explore historic sites like the Batonis Tsikhe fortress, visit local wineries for Georgian wine tasting, and enjoy the charming old town. The city also offers cultural experiences at museums and monasteries, and scenic views of the surrounding vineyards and landscapes.
